2014 Red Burgundies: Delicious Terroir-Driven Midweights (Mar 2017)

Deep ruby-red. Deeply pitched yet rather explosive aromas of black cherry, black raspberry, smoky minerals and chocolate. Large-scaled and plush on the palate, combining an impression of chocolatey ripeness with a distinct medicinal reserve. Finishes with a burst of black cherry and a firm tannic spine that tempers the wine’s sweetness and extends the fruit.
